If your family was in a difficult situation, would you risk your life for them? Would you save them even if that meant putting your life in danger? Loving your family is important and being loyal to family can bring you closer to them. Love and loyalty can make you do crazy things for the people that you care about. Rikki-Tikki is a loyal and loving character in the story. For instance, Nag tries to kill Rikki-Tikki’s family and to save his family, Rikki-Tikki kills Nag. (par.58) This proves that he is loving and caring and will do anything to protect his family. Rikki-Tikki took a risk to save his family even if it meant putting his life in danger. In addition, an evil character named Nagaina tries to kill Rikki-Tikki’s family, but Rikki-Tikki saves them. (par.83-86) This proves that Rikki-Tikki is loyal. He saved the people that took care of him in the beginning of the story even though they weren’t his real family. He loves his family and is loyal to them. In …show more content…
In the story, Nagaina tells her husband Nag to kill Rikki-Tikki’s family so that they can have the garden to themselves. (par.49-52) This proves that Nagaina is Selfish. She wants to kill an innocent family so that she and her husband can have the garden all to themselves. This character trait is different from Rikki-Tikki because Rikki-Tikki is loyal. Rikki-Tikki would never do that to anyone. In addition, Nag was killed and Nagaina wanted revenge. She wanted to kill the family for killing Nag. (par.84) This proves that Nagaina is determined. She wanted Nag to kill Rikki-Tikki’s family but he didn’t succeed, so she decided to kill the family herself.
